Manage your Credit Builder card

Legacy product: Credit Builder is no longer available to new members. If you already have a Credit Builder account, you can keep using it.


Credit Builder is a secured Visa® credit card — your spending limit equals whatever you have in your Secured Deposit Account (SDA). To start spending, you just need to move money into Credit Builder, which is held in your SDA. There's no interest and no annual fee.


You can use your virtual card right away in the Chime app. You'll see a separate Credit Builder balance alongside your Checking Account balance. The Credit Builder balance reflects exactly what's in your SDA.

When your card expires

If your Credit Builder card is approaching its expiration date, Chime will issue you a new Credit Builder card so you can keep your account active.
